         <title>Great Depression</title>
         <author>9959700</author>
         <link>https://padlet.com/9961417/q9fpd76z33jfqppm/wish/758901175</link>
         <description><![CDATA[<div>Following the wall street crash in 1929, considerable investment from the US following war debt settlements were withdrawn. Farmers were hard hit by the drop in crop prices, and industry suffered as demand decreased. Wages fell as unemployment rose. The Italian people were looking for any solution of a stable economic state. </div>]]></description>

         <title>Did this effect landowners and factory owners?</title>
         <author>9961417</author>
         <link>https://padlet.com/9961417/q9fpd76z33jfqppm/wish/758914051</link>
         <description><![CDATA[<div>Yes, landowners and factory owners were faced with activism from the working class, and were afraid of the rise in socialist and communist support. They did not want their land confiscated from them or for their workers to take over the factories, leaving them with no control. Fascism was anti-communist, so it appealed the middle class who was afraid of socialism.</div>]]></description>
